    Sammanfattning : Intermediation is a central concept in the marketing channel literature where it is used for analyzing how specific firms, intermediaries, connect producers and users. It is argued that intermediation is primarily about increasing transaction efficiency when intermediaries undertake functions for closing the gap between producer stocks and consumer assortments, thus bridging discrepancies in time and place between supply and demand.     Sammanfattning : Computing education has struggled with student engagement and diversity in the student population for a long time. Research in science, technology, engineering, and mathematics (STEM) education suggests that taking a social, long-term perspective on learning is a fruitful approach to resolving some of these persistent challenges.
